Ingredients
Scale
Fudge Base
- 2 cups white chocolate chips
- 6 oz sweetened condensed milk
Topping
- 2 cups crushed candy canes
Instructions
- Prepare the pan: Line an 8×8 inch baking pan with parchment paper to prevent sticking and for easy removal of the fudge later.
- Crush the candy canes: Place candy canes inside a gallon-sized ziplock bag, seal it tightly, and crush them using a rolling pin until you have about 2 cups of crushed candy canes for the recipe.
- Melt chocolate and condensed milk: In the top pot of a double boiler set over medium-high heat, combine the white chocolate chips and sweetened condensed milk. Stir continuously until the mixture is fully melted, smooth, and creamy.
- Mix in candy canes: Stir in 1 cup of the crushed candy canes into the melted chocolate mixture, blending thoroughly for even peppermint flavor throughout the fudge.
- Pour into pan and add topping: Pour the fudge mixture into the prepared baking pan, spreading it evenly. Then sprinkle the remaining 1 cup of crushed candy canes on top, pressing them gently into the fudge to secure them.
- Chill to set: Place the pan in the refrigerator for 4 to 6 hours, or for quicker setting, place it in the freezer for about 2 hours until firm.
- Slice and serve: Once set, lift the fudge out of the pan using the parchment paper. Allow it to thaw at room temperature for 30 minutes before slicing into squares to enjoy.
Notes
- This fudge is incredibly easy with just three ingredients, making it a perfect last-minute holiday dessert.
- Using a double boiler helps melt the chocolate gently, preventing burning and ensuring smooth texture.
- For best results, press the crushed candy canes gently on top so the topping sticks well.
- Store leftover fudge in an airtight container in the refrigerator to keep it fresh.
- You can substitute candy canes with peppermint candies if desired, but the texture and bite may differ slightly.
